Even Today, treehouses are constructed by some native people so as to escape the danger and hardship on the ground in some parts of the tropics. It has been maintained that the majority of the Korowai clans, a Papuan tribe at the southeast of Irian Jaya, live in tree houses on their isolated land as defense against a tribe of Arabian head-hunters, the Citak.The BBC revealed in 2018 that the Korowai had assembled tree houses"for the benefit of overseas programme makers" and did not really live in them. On the other hand, the Korowai people still build tree houses, but not elevated on stilts as in the BBC scene, but secured to trees from the tree trunks of tall trees, to protect occupants and save food from scavenging animals.

In contemporary societiesModern Tree homes are usually constructed as a hut for children or for leisure purposes. Contemporary tree houses may also be incorporated into existing hotel facilities.

Together with underground and ground level houses, tree houses are An alternative for building eco-friendly homes in remote forest areas, since they don't require a clearing of some specific area of woods. However, the wildlife, illumination and climate on ground level in areas of dense close-canopy woods isn't desirable to some folks.There are numerous tactics to secure the structure to the tree which seek to minimize tree damage. Struts and stilts are used for relieving weights on a lower altitude or straight to the floor; Tree homes supported by stilts weigh less on the tree and help to prevent stress, possible strain, and harm brought on by puncture holes. Stilts are generally anchored to the ground with concrete but fresh designs, like the"Diamond Pier", accelerates installation time and they are less invasive for the origin system. Stilts are considered the easiest way of encouraging larger tree houses, and can also raise structural support and security.Stay sticks are used for relieving weights onto a higher elevation. All these Systems are particularly useful to restrain movements brought on by wind or tree growth, however they're the used less frequently, due to the natural limitations of the systems. Higher elevation and much more branches tailing off decreases capacity and increases end sensibility. As building materials such as hanging are utilized ropes, wire cables, pressure fasteners, springs etc..

Friction and stress fasteners are the most popular noninvasive methods of securing tree homes. They don't utilize nails, screws or bolts, but rather grip the beams into the trunk by means of counter-beam, threaded bars, or tying.Invasive methodsInvasive methods are methods that use screws, nails, bolts, As these methods require punctures from the tree, they must be planned properly so as to reduce stress. Not many species of plants suffer from puncture in precisely the same style, depending partly on whether the sap conduits run in the pith or from the bark. Nails are usually not suggested. A distinctive kind of bolt developed in the 1990s called a treehouse attachment spool (TAB) can support greater weights than earlier methods.

Since the mid-1990s, recreational tree homes have enjoyed a growth in popularity in countries such as the United States and parts of Europe. This was due to greater disposable income, better technology for builders, study to secure building practices and an increased interest in environmental problems , especially sustainable living. This growing popularity can be reflected in an increase of social networking channels, sites, and television shows especially devoted to featuring remarkable tree homes around the world. {There are over 30 companies in Europe and the USA specializing in the construction of tree homes of various degrees of permanence and sophistication, from children's play structures to fully functioning homes.

Many areas of the world Don't Have Any specific preparation laws for tree Houses, therefore the legal issues could be confusing to both the contractor and the local planning departments just. Treehouses can be exempt, partially regulated or fully regulated - based on the locale.Sometimes, tree homes are exempted from regular building Regulations, since they are considered outside of the regulations specification. An exemption could be given to a builder in case the tree home is in a remote or non-urban location. Alternatively, a tree house may be included in the exact same class as structures such as garden sheds, sometimes known as a"temporary construction". There could be limitations on elevation, distance from boundary and privacy for nearby properties. There are various grey areas in these laws, since they weren't specifically designed for tree-borne structures. A very small number of planning departments have regulations for tree homes, which set out clearly what may be built and where. Much like an on-ground structure, you should begin with building your base and floor. You might face complications with the shape of your flooring due to the limitations of branches that are appropriate to base off of.Due to this, there's a possibility you might need to settle for a non-square shape. This May be what you want, or this might be a problem for you. In any situation, you should understand there are some limitations put upon you by the particular tree you are working with. All branches used for a foundation should be able to single-handedly carry several hundred pounds, and more if you're expecting higher traffic.

Large tree homes that consider more than the collective weight of the occupants should be designed carefully, As various facets such as the hardness of the shrub along with fastener quality and layout come more to play. Wood will compress in which the fasteners connect to the tree to varying degrees based on the hardness of the shrub in question, resulting in a sinking of the tree home.

There are many different tree home fasteners available on the market today made specifically for their distinctive needs. But the question invariably arises as to how necessary these customized bolts and brackets Are in comparison to ordinary ones located in home centers due to their price. They often cost between a couple of hundred dollars per year!These rather expensive parts of hardware is the trees are living organisms, and are still growing, moving, and changing shape. Thus, your tree home and the hardware where it is mounted must accommodate this movement. Simply bolting the beams into the tree's branches results in a fixed attachment that can induce the tree to pull the screw through the beam or try to grow around the beam.The first of the two will result in a dangerous and sudden failure, While the next will cause an unhealthy and unnatural growth around the ray, possibly causing decay and disease to install. Customized brackets and bolts are made with a particular allowance for tree growth, with a section of the bolt that's embedded deep inside the tree's heartwood and a massive shank which allows axial movement coupled with a female part that is attached to the beam.

Yesif you lack the know-how to discover parts that will accomplish the same purpose as the skilled components do, then no, if you do, and do not need your tree house to endure for fifty decades. Home centers sell hardware and bolts with large diameters and lengths that could be utilized, but the entire shank cannot be threaded.The half so that Is embedded into the tree must be threaded, but the rest that acts as the cushion to compensate for tree-growth has to be smooth. You also need a feminine piece that fits around the smooth shank that has a bracket that can be screwed into your own column. This feminine bracket then gets the liberty to slide across the axis of the smooth bolt shank as the tree grows in girth. All parts should be stainless steel too - others may rust to collapse.
